I watercolored this flower. I doodled with a white gel pen and a black ink pen. I masked the flower and stamped the musical background. Using Aleene's tacky glue and a palette knife I spread the glue through a STAMPlorations stencil called RAW ONIONS. I lifted the stencil and added the gilding flakes. I added brads in the corners to finish off the card. I really liked how this turned out.
